This pyrophyllite is from the Graves Moutain Mine in Lincoln County, Georgia, USA. This was an open pit operation that was mined for the recovery of kyanite. Several accessory minerals including rutile, lazulite and pyrophyllite are found there. Pyrophyllite is a silicate that contains the elements Al, Si, O and H. This specimen consists of interpenetrating, accicular, clusters of pyrophyllite crystals with minor hematite. The pyrophyllite crystals have a micaceous luster and the hematite gives some of them a copper color with a reddish contrast. This piece measures 5 1/2 x 4 x 2 inches or 140 x 100 x 50 mm.
